avalanche — full definition

  1. noun A large mass of snow and ice that suddenly breaks loose and slides down a mountainside.
  2. noun A sudden, overwhelming amount of something arriving all at once.
  3. verb To come down or arrive suddenly and overwhelmingly, like an avalanche.

deluge — full definition

  1. noun A sudden, heavy flood of water, or an overwhelming rainstorm.
  2. noun An overwhelming amount of anything arriving at once.
  3. verb To overwhelm someone with a large amount of something.
